This was reported earlier this week Margaret RidleyThe Rey Skywalker film, entitled Star Wars: New Jedi Order he had problems and that screenwriter Steven Knight (Peaky Blinders) hasn’t had a chance to write the screenplay yet, which would delay the making of the film.

The news came from a respectable person Star Wars news site Making Star Wars. Well, now io9 reports that those rumors are not true. They say Lucasfilm told them that “the report is not accurate and Knight continues to write and be part of the process. In fact, as you read this, the company is waiting for its latest draft.

There was also a rumor that we didn’t report that Lucasfilm had creative differences with Knight. Regardless of what’s going on, one thing we know for sure from both sources is that Lucasfilm has yet to have a script for the film, and when that script eventually arrives, that script will have to be greenlit.

Remember, Damon Lindelof AND Sharmeen Obaid-Chinoy they were initially hired to write a screenplay for the film, which they did, but Lucasfilm didn’t like the direction they were taking the story and the studios ended up firing them from the project. So even when Knight finishes his script, there’s no guarantee it will be what Lucasfilm is looking for.
